Transaction 317282692718433c980afb540fd494e5083a0be3c1b4d48c57f7afbea1a250ef

1 Input
2 Outputs
  • 317282692718433c980afb540fd494e5083a0be3c1b4d48c57f7afbea1a250ef:0
  • value  35462129
    address  1MX9eXRWoMhNabSBTPvENPn9w9gMfdrnJm
  • 317282692718433c980afb540fd494e5083a0be3c1b4d48c57f7afbea1a250ef:1
  • value  5950303
    address  1CQ4cZFMpY8vpd988tsjNFyZFttWFUx4UG